On May 10, 2022, the founder of the start-up "D+ for Care" Claire DEspagne, sparked controversy after her interview for the podcast "Freedom of Entrepreneurship", in which she deplores "the disappearance of interns who refuse to work 80 hours per week. The magnitude of the reactions is commensurate with a current problem. Indeed, in the world of work, there is an opposition between the expectations of young people and the requirements of companies. The importance given to mental health and the balance between private and professional life makes them particularly sensitive and attentive to the conditions of their employment. Ecological issues also worry a large number of young people: some graduates of the Ecole Polytechnique have publicly questioned the companies through which they could be hired by refusing to "participate in a world they denounce", during their graduation ceremony. Graduation. They are not the only ones: a growing number of students, especially from the Grandes Ecoles, are following the trend. However, for companies there is a real difficulty in responding to this emphasis on the social dimension, through the constraint of productivity. According to the CEO of Carrefour Alexandre Bompard, we have entered a “crisogenic” environment which imposes itself on business leaders.
